Output 8091fecf810cca5d4ad21846199b48c130056eea0a43296f0d35b2187c35a8f2:1

value
29403996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26b4df768513f3a4bc30f975627987d7de52a8c OP_EQUAL
address
MUYMVSC65LJfX4tjkzsdQfvsteas8jxj2R
transaction
8091fecf810cca5d4ad21846199b48c130056eea0a43296f0d35b2187c35a8f2
spent
true